Coffee tastes like chocolate because of the roast level of coffee beans and the origin of the coffee beans. Roast level of the coffee beans. The roast level of coffee beans is a significant factor influencing coffee's taste. Coffee beans have a soft texture and a light color when harvested. They, however, become dark and hard because of roasting.

Coffee is one of those drinks that goes perfectly well with chocolate and sometimes even tastes like it. This is why coffee-based desserts like tiramisu or café mocha are so popular. However, coffee on its own can sometimes have some nutty, chocolatey notes. Why is that? Similarities Between Coffee and Chocolate.
